Ticket: the Quillbox PDF invoice renderer clips line-item tables when a plugin injects custom footer blocks taller than 90pt. Observed with the Marrowgate tax-summary extension; layout engine reflows the page but forgets the footer reservation. Plugin authors should cap footer height until the fix ships. Reproductions should cite the renderer trace token below.

session token of tajef-bageg = htk21_5d90d574934f3ccae6437

- [ ] Step 7: Archive cold storage buckets (Glacierline tier). Confirm both ceremony witnesses are present, verify bucket manifests match the Oxbow ledger, then seal the archive key shares. Plugin authors may observe but not handle shares. Once sealed, the archive index itself is encrypted and can only be reopened with the passphrase below.

vault phrase of badup-hahig = tamael-aldael-kelmir-istael-fenok-istwyn-tamius-jorath-oliion

The renewal of our three-year agreement with Torvane Materials has been assessed in detail. Proposed terms include a 4.2% unit-price increase, partially offset by improved volume rebates and extended payment terms of sixty days. Sensitivity analysis indicates a net annual cost impact of under 1% on the Meridia product line, assuming stable demand. Legal has flagged no material changes to liability clauses. We recommend approval, subject to the conditions outlined in the confidential note below.

confidential, yawip-bahif: Zorokox Partners plans to lower the Casax list price by 28.0 percent in April. The board signed off on a budget of $271.0 million for Project Juldor. The renewal with Pelokox Partners closes at $410.1 million a year, 3.4 percent below the last contract. Project Pelok slips by a full year because of the audit delay.

Subject: Quickstore 4.2 — bloom filter now fronts the KV layer

Plugin authors: starting with this release, Quickstore places a bloom filter ahead of the key-value store. Negative lookups return faster; false positives fall through safely. No API changes are required on your side. Verify your plugin against the staging build referenced below.

session token of fahif-tadup = htk3_9c7

# Break-glass: Tarnbeck tax-rate cache

If the Tarnbeck rate-lookup cache serves stale jurisdictions and normal invalidation fails, use break-glass access. Scope: flush and reseed only. Log the incident before and after. Access auto-expires in 30 minutes. Unlock the break-glass console with the recovery passphrase below.

unlock words, yawig-kagef: gordor-holvan-ulaael-pramir-ulaiel-tamdor